Pine-Richland SD · April 14, 2026
Pine-Richland SD administrators presented staffing recommendations to reduce seven full-time equivalents through attrition for the 2026–27 school year to help close a reported $4.7 million operating budget deficit; parents and staff urged the board to reconsider cuts affecting special education and student programs.
